Kharar
Kharar is a village located in Nawadiha Bazar Nawadiha subdivision of Palamu district in Jharkhand, India. It is situated 3km away from sub-district headquarter Nawadiha Bazar/nawadiha (tehsildar office) and 70km away from district headquarter Palamu. As per 2009 stats, Cherai 2 is the gram panchayat of Kharar village.

About Kharar
According to Census 2011, the location code or village code of Kharar is 365617. The village spans a total geographical area of 199 hectares, and the pincode of the locality is 822113. Nawadiha Bazar Nawadiha is nearest town to Kharar village for all major economic activities.

Population of Kharar
According to the 2011 Census, Kharar has a total population of about 684, with approximately 355 males and 329 females. The sex ratio is around 926 females per 1,000 males. Children aged 0 to 6 years make up about 118 of the population, showing the young generation present in the village. There are about 421 members of the Scheduled Castes (SC), an important community in the village. The Scheduled Tribes (ST) population numbers around 3. The overall literacy rate is approximately 37.87%, with male literacy at about 43.38% and female literacy near 31.91%. There are around 145 households in the village. Particulars | Total | Male | Female |
---|---|---|---|
Total Population | 684 | 355 | 329 |
Child Population (0–6 yrs) | 118 | 52 | 66 |
Scheduled Castes (SC) | 421 | 204 | 217 |
Scheduled Tribes (ST) | 3 | 2 | 1 |
Literate Population | 259 | 154 | 105 |
Illiterate Population | 425 | 201 | 224 |
Connectivity of Kharar
Connectivity plays a major role in improving access, opportunities, and overall development of villages like Kharar. As per the 2011 stats, Kharar had access to public bus service, private bus service and railway station.
Connectivity Type | Status (in year 2011) |
---|---|
Public Bus Service | Available within 10+ km distance |
Private Bus Service | Available within <5 km distance |
Railway Station | Available within 10+ km distance |
